Where this is useful
YouTube is increasingly where students learn — full university courses, tutorial channels, explainer videos for hard concepts. The problem is that video is hard to review: you can't skim it the way you skim a PDF, and you can't search it for a specific term. Turning a video into a note solves both problems. The note is skimmable, searchable, and editable — and the flashcards and quizzes built from the same source give you active-recall practice.
